Bactrian camel
Two-humped camel of Central Asia, key to Silk Road caravans.
The Bactrian camel, also called the Mongolian or two-humped camel, is native to Central Asia’s steppes. Unlike the single-humped dromedary, it has two humps. Most of its roughly 2 million members are domesticated. Its name comes from the ancient region of Bactria. Since ancient times, these camels have been used as pack animals in inner Asia, and their ability to endure cold, drought, and high altitudes made Silk Road caravans possible.
In taxonomy, the Bactrian camel shares the genus *Camelus* with the dromedary and the wild Bactrian camel (*C. ferus*). It belongs to the family Camelidae. The Greek philosopher Aristotle was the first European to describe camels, noting both the one-humped Arabian and two-humped Bactrian types in his 4th-century BCE *History of Animals*. Swedish zoologist Carl Linnaeus gave the Bactrian camel its scientific name, *Camelus bactrianus*, in his 1758 work *Systema Naturae*. Although the domestic Bactrian camel shares a closer common ancestor with the wild Bactrian camel than with the dromedary, it did not descend from it; the two species split hundreds of thousands of years ago, with their mitochondrial genomes diverging about 1 million years ago. Genetic evidence links both Bactrian camel species to the extinct giant camel *Camelus knoblochi*, which died out around 20,000 years ago and is equally related to both.
The Bactrian camel and the dromedary often interbreed and produce fertile offspring. Where their ranges overlap—such as in northern Punjab, Iran, and Afghanistan—their physical differences tend to blur due to extensive crossbreeding. This hybrid fertility has led some to suggest the two should be considered a single species with two varieties. However, a 1994 analysis of the mitochondrial cytochrome b gene found a 10.3% divergence in their sequences.
The Bactrian camel is the largest mammal in its native range and the largest living camel, though it is shorter at the shoulder than the dromedary. Shoulder height ranges from 160 to 180 cm (5.2–5.9 ft), total height from 230 to 250 cm (7.5–8.2 ft), head-and-body length from 225 to 350 cm (7.38–11.48 ft), and tail length from 35 to 55 cm (14–22 in). At the top of the humps, average height is 213 cm (6.99 ft). Body mass varies from 300 to 1,000 kg (660–2,200 lb), with males averaging about 600 kg (1,300 lb) and females about 480 kg (1,060 lb). Its long, woolly coat ranges from dark brown to sandy beige, with a mane and beard of long hair on the neck and throat that can reach 25 cm (9.8 in). The shaggy winter coat sheds very quickly, with large patches peeling off at once. The two humps are made of fat, not water. The face is long and somewhat triangular, with a split upper lip. Long eyelashes and sealable nostrils help keep out dust during sandstorms. Each foot has two broad toes with undivided soles that spread wide for walking on sand, and the feet are very tough.
These camels are migratory, living in habitats from rocky mountains to flat steppe, arid desert (mostly the Gobi Desert), stony plains, and sand dunes. Conditions are extreme: sparse vegetation, limited water, and temperatures from as low as −30 °C (−22 °F) in winter to 50 °C (122 °F) in summer. Their distribution depends on water availability, with large groups gathering near rivers after rain, at mountain springs in summer, or where snow is available in winter.
Bactrian camels handle huge temperature swings and can go months without water, but when water is available they may drink up to 57 L (13 imp gal; 15 US gal). A thirsty camel in a hot, dry season can consume up to 200 L (44 imp gal; 53 US gal) in a single day. When well fed, their humps are plump and upright; when resources are scarce, they shrink and lean to one side. At speeds faster than a walk, they pace—moving both legs on the same side forward together—rather than trot. They have been recorded at speeds up to 65 km/h (40 mph) but rarely move that fast, usually sustaining about 40 km/h (25 mph). Domestic Bactrian camels have been seen swimming. Their sight is good, and their sense of smell is excellent. In the wild, they can live up to 50 years, though the average is around 30; domesticated ones have not been recorded living beyond 35 years.
Bactrian camels are diurnal, sleeping in the open at night and foraging during the day. They are mainly herbivores.

Reader's Guide
The Bactrian camel's significance lies in its historical role as a pack animal on the Silk Road, enabling trade across inner Asia due to its tolerance for cold, drought, and high altitudes. It is a separate species from the wild Bactrian camel (Camelus ferus), with the two having split around 1 million years ago. Domestic Bactrian camels do not descend from wild Bactrian camels. The species shares the genus Camelus with the dromedary and the wild Bactrian camel. It was first described by Aristotle in the 4th century BCE and given its binomial name by Carl Linnaeus in 1758. Their ability to withstand extreme temperatures, go without water for months, and eat a wide range of vegetation, including snow, allows them to thrive in harsh environments. They are induced ovulators, with gestation lasting around 13 months, and young are precocial. Domesticated for thousands of years, they are bred by pastoralist and agricultural communities across Central Asia, the Middle East, and parts of China and Mongolia, with breeding practices focusing on hardiness, milk production, load-bearing ability, and temperament.
